Cubic senary (base 6) dice uniquely harness the power of the base 6 number system and generate random numbers from a predetermined set of consecutive numbers, each tending to occur with the same relative frequency. Cubic senary dice have numerical values corresponding to the place values of the base 6 number system, and face values corresponding to the senary notational digits (0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5). Notational digits on cubic senary dice have two values: an intrinsic value-which is that signified by the isolated symbol itself, and a local value-the value possessed by the numeral by virtue of the power of its die, 60, 61, 62, etc. The magnitude of the senary number cast is a sum of products involving powers of the number 6.A random senary number is obtained by casting the dice and reading the notational digits returned from each die cast, in order, from the highest to the lowest power die. The random senary number is converted to its decimal equivalent with a calculator. A cast of just seven cubic senary dice can generate any one of 67 or 279,936 random senary numbers ranging from 0 to 5,555,555 consecutively-equivalent to the decimal numbers 0 to 279,935. The number off cubic senary dice cast would vary depending on user needs; or sample size-the set of consecutive numbers from which the user wants to select random numbers.
